Copper, aluminium, and zinc prices are rallying globally amid supply constraints, strong demand, geopolitical tensions, and green energy transitions. China continues to dominate consumption. Short-term corrections are possible, but structural factors support a long-term bullish outlook, especially for metals critical to energy, infrastructure, and EV development.
